TO MY PHOTOGRAPH: A.D. 1897 by KATE CRICHTON GREDLER

First Line: DEAR, ROUND-EYED ONE, I WISH I KNEW
Last Line: TO YOUR DEWY CHARM AND YOUR SMUG COMPLACENCE.
Subject(s): PHOTOGRAPHY & PHOTOGRAPHERS; SELF;

Dear, round-eyed one, I wish I knew
As little about life as you!
Or that I felt one-half as certain
Of a happy end at the final curtain.
Across the years I make obeisance
To your dewy charm and your smug complacence.
